Nullstack features and specs

  • Full-Stack Capabilities
    Nullstack allows for the development of both client-side and server-side functionalities within a single project, providing a more unified development process.
  • Seamless SSR
    It offers built-in support for server-side rendering, improving performance and SEO without the need for complex configurations.
  • Zero tooling
    Nullstack provides a setup that requires minimal configuration and does not depend heavily on additional tools, simplifying the development workflow.
  • Component-based Architecture
    Promotes the use of components, encouraging modularity and reusability of code, which can improve maintainability and scalability of applications.
  • Hot Module Replacement
    Supports HMR, allowing developers to see immediate changes in their applications without refreshing the entire page, improving development efficiency.

Possible disadvantages of Nullstack

  • Smaller Community
    Compared to more established frameworks, Nullstack has a smaller community, which can result in fewer resources and third-party tools.
  • Learning Curve
    Developers need to learn the Nullstack-specific ways of handling both front-end and back-end development, which might be a hurdle for those accustomed to other frameworks.
  • Limited Ecosystem
    Due to its newer and less widely adopted nature, there might be limited third-party libraries and plugins readily available compared to more mature frameworks.
  • Rapidly Evolving
    Being relatively new and possibly evolving quickly, developers might face breaking changes more frequently compared to more established technologies.

Analysis of WinPaletter

Overall verdict

  • WinPaletter is a solid, free, open-source utility for deeply customizing Windows color schemes, offering far more granular control than the built-in Windows personalization settings.

Why this product is good

  • It's completely free and open-source with active development on GitHub
  • Allows precise customization of Windows colors, including elements not exposed in standard settings like the classic theme, DWM, and console colors
  • Supports creating, saving, importing, and exporting themes for easy sharing and backup
  • Works across multiple Windows versions including Windows 7, 8, 10, and 11
  • Portable option available so no full installation is required
  • Provides live preview so you can see changes before applying them

Recommended for

  • Windows enthusiasts who want deep control over their system's appearance
  • Users who find the default Windows personalization options too limited
  • Theme creators who want to build and share custom color palettes
  • People customizing older Windows versions where built-in options are sparse
  • Developers and power users comfortable with community-driven, open-source tools
